Ron Hays who manages the Orlando office, is a co-founder of Sawtek Inc., and served as Vice President of Sales and Marketing for Sawtek from 1979 until 1986 during which time Sawtek grew from a startup to the largest manufacturer of SAW components in the U.S. Thereafter, as Vice President of Engineering, he led Sawtek's entry into subsystems development and manufacture from 1986 until 1991. As a consultant after 1991, he continued to support Sawtek's engineering, sales, and marketing activities focused successfully on developing and winning major multi-million dollar subsystem opportunities. In 1993 Ron co-founded WaveLink Associates with Tom O'Shea.

Ron who previously has had sales responsibility for Florida and North/South Carolina and Virginia serves the other Sales Engineers as backup throughout the Southeast, and in addition to his corporate duties he provides the inside sales engineering function.

Tom O'Shea, recruited by Sawtek in its early years from Motorola in 1981, served Sawtek in several key individual roles, as the Engineering Manager of SAW Oscillators and Hybrid Products, and as Vice President for new business development. Until going forward to start WaveLink with Ron and throughout most of his Sawtek career, he had principal responsibility for all major proposal work and sales of oscillator and hybrid products and was responsible for the development of many state-of-the-art oscillator products.

From his office in northeast Atlanta, Tom covers key accounts in Atlanta as well as Kentucky and eastern Tennessee and temporarily shares account responsibility with Bob Kerrigan in North Carolina and with Michael McCorkle in South Carolina.

Bob Kerrigan's professional career includes 27 years of sales and marketing experience with Varian, Emerson & Cuming, and Alpha Industries and as an engineering sales representative. The technical foundation for his high technology sales career comes from many years of successful design and project engineering experience in the microwave component and phased array antenna areas. He has directed field sales offices with sales volume up to $50 million annually and more recently had served as President of Microwave Marketing, an electronics sales representative company founded in Florida over 30 years ago.

Bob joined WaveLink in January, 1995. Bob covers the Panhandle of Florida and the Gulf Coast including the Tampa/St. Petersburg/Clearwater area and shares account responsibility with Tom O'Shea in North Carolina and southern Virginia.

Michael McCorkle joined WaveLink Associates as a sales engineer in 2000, with 18 years of engineering and sales experience. During his eleven years at Gould from 1984 to 1995, he progressed through applications and sales engineering roles to become most recently the National Sales Program manager for digital storage oscilloscopes. His prior technical and sales experience include numerous products such as electronic test equipment, data acquisition systems, distributed control products, plotters and recorders, analyzers, and emulators.

During the last five years as a manufacturers representative, he has focused on sales and support of OEM customers and end users involved in telecommunications, computers and networking, utilities, and other electronic markets in the Southeast. Michael has responsibility for several key accounts in the Atlanta area and also covers the territory west of Atlanta including Georgia, Alabama, Mississippi, and western Tennessee and shares responsibility for South Carolina with Tom OíShea.

Frank Hauns joined WaveLink Associates as a sales engineer in October 2006 with over 40 years Rf & Microwave engineering and sales experience. He joined the USN in 1965 and left the service in 1969 as an ATR-2 (E-r) after being stationed worldwide with the VQ-2 squadron where he was part of the air and ground crews maintaining
and operating radar, radio and ECM avionics equipment. After the service, he obtained an Associate in Technology degree from Temple University and BSEE degree from Drexel University with evening classes while working full time as an engineering technician at RCA Mobile Communication Division and Solid State Scientific.

Upon graduation, Frank was an application engineering manager at MSC and ST Microelectronics Bipolar & GasAsFET facilities and then a consultant for the MSC amplifier group after it was purchased by ST Microelectronics. After MPD bought the MSC amplifier group, Frank moved to Florida in 1992 as a Field Sales Engineer for M. Lader Co., and Sr. Sales Engineer for Richardson Electronics. Frank covers the Atlantic Coast of Florida including the Kennedy Space Center and south through the Miami area.
